Clock Buffers, Drivers Texas Instruments CDCLVP2108RGZT Overview

The Texas Instruments CDCLVP2108RGZT is a high-performance clock buffer designed to address the demanding needs of complex digital systems. Featuring a robust 1:16 distribution ratio, this IC ensures precise clock distribution at speeds up to 2 GHz, housed in a compact 48-VQFN package. The device's exceptional capability to handle high frequencies makes it an ideal choice for systems requiring reliable, high-speed signal processing and distribution. With its precision and efficiency, the Clock Buffers, Drivers Texas Instruments CDCLVP2108RGZT stands out as a strategic component for designers looking to optimize system performance while maintaining signal integrity in high-speed environments.

CDCLVP2108RGZT Features

This clock buffer from Texas Instruments features a broad frequency range up to 2 GHz, enabling it to support high-speed applications efficiently. Its low-jitter performance enhances system reliability by minimizing timing errors and ensuring stable operations across various conditions. The device's 1:16 fanout capacity allows for extensive clock distribution within large-scale integrated circuits, making it a versatile choice for complex digital architectures.
